Tender description

This procurement covers the design and construction of 3 x pumping stations, namely Martham pumping station, Potter Heigham pumping station and Brograve pumping station. It also allows for the optionality of adding one additional similar pumping station site namely Somerton South Pumping Station and Culvert or Repps pumping station at a future date. Each of these sites has an existing pumping station which will need to be decommissioned. Any instruction for one of the two optional sites is expected to be within 12 months of the Contract Date. The value was estimated at £8-£12million for the initial 3 sites with up to a further £6million for the fourth site depending on works required. These figures are exclusive of VAT. These works are to be funded from Environment Agency Grant in Aid. The works and its objectives are entirely consistent to ensure compliance with the BIDB statutory duties as a Section 28g body under the Wildlife and Countryside Act 1981 (as amended). The scope of the works:  Design and construction for the 3 pumping stations. Design is limited to the following design tasks (Refer Section S300 of the Scope)  Telemetry system  External lighting  Control kiosk including HVAC  Motor Control Centre and full electrical system design including Functional Design Specification  Stop log systems and non return / control valves  Ducting and draw pit numbers and dimensions  Precast Concrete Units  MCC support frame  Temporary works including relevant licences, permissions and consents  Associated civil, mechanical and electrical works  Integration with existing water infrastructure  Testing, commissioning and handover to operations  Sectional Completion  Decommissioning of existing 3 pumping stations  Potential for all of the above for 4th site. ## Contract award Title: Upper Thurne Package 2 Construction Works
